Aprilia SMV750 Dorsoduro vs GasGas SM 700 ergonomics
Aprilia SMV750 Dorsoduro and GasGas SM 700 have modeled posture scores within three points for the 183 cm default rider. Treat this as a planning estimate; posture preference, data confidence, and a real test sit still matter.

Rider fit: reaching the ground
The Aprilia SMV750 Dorsoduro lists a 899 mm seat; the GasGas SM 700 lists 898 mm, within a few millimetres of each other. Seat height is only a first-pass ground-reach input. It does not establish safety or actual foot contact. Seat width, suspension sag, boots, mobility, load, and individual proportions can materially change the result.
Geometry snapshot
| Spec | Aprilia SMV750 Dorsoduro | GasGas SM 700 |
|---|---|---|
| Seat height | 899 mm | 898 mm |
| Wheelbase | 1,506 mm | 1,476 mm |
| Wet weight | 206 kg | - |
| Displacement | 750 cc | 693 cc |
